Whether you’re taking your first holiday abroad this year or you’re a Magaluf veteran and are thinking of going somewhere new, The Student Pocket Guide has your definitive guide to 5 of the best party destinations around the world.

Ibiza – This isle is well known for its dance music culture. Famous DJ’s from around the world play at Ibiza’s clubs every night. So, it is no surprise this is one of the most popular party destinations in summer. Dancing all night in well-known clubs such as Space, Pacha and Amnesia are what makes Ibiza such an ideal party spot. However, do keep in mind that these venues are not cheap. Tickets for events typically cost £25-50 and once inside a bottle of water can cost up to £10.

Marbella – If you’re looking for a slightly more sophisticated holiday, then this destination in Spain is the place to be. Situated in the heart of the Costa del Sol, Marbella is considered the new place to be and be seen. If you fancy dancing till the sun comes up, late night venue, Olivia Valere is open till 7 a.m. Celebrities such as Kate Moss and Maria Carey have been known to frequent this club. Olivia Valere does have a dress-code however, so flip-flops and shorts are probably a no-go.

Ayia Napa – One of Europe’s top party destinations, Ayia Napa offers sandy beaches, blazing sunshine and clear waters. Famed for its grime, garage and RnB nights, this Cyprus clubbing capital regularly hosts artists such as Roll Deep, Tinie Tempah and Wiley. With clubs open till dawn there’s plenty of time to dance the night away with like-minded party people. There are also a load of water sports on offer, so if you’re not too tired from the night before, you can try your hand at windsurfing, canoeing or scuba-diving!

Cancun – Originally the stomping ground for American teenagers on Spring break, this Mexican party hot spot is becoming more and more popular with British tourists. With all-inclusive “party package” deals and DJ line-ups to rival Ibiza, Cancun is quickly becoming the party place to be in summer.

Novalja – This town on the island of Pag in Croatia is a reasonably new party destination but is already renowned for its happening nightlife. Novalja also has a beautiful cultural town centre which, if you’re not too hungover, can be enjoyed in the daytime. If you fancy clubbing somewhere slightly different this summer then Novalja could be the place for you. Food and drink prices are extremely reasonable and the parties on Zrce Beach are unmissable!
